About Bat Boy
Meet Bat Boy. He spent over 100 days at the shelter—a stretch that made him a favorite among volunteers. This soulful, easygoing guy finds a way into people's hearts without any effort at all. Bat Boy clocks in at about 5 years old and is around 50 pounds, with the ideal mix of playful spirit and laid-back attitude. He’s crate trained and house trained, walks well on leash, and easily fits into any home routine. He’s thriving in foster care, living peacefully with three other dogs of various sizes and a cat. Everyone gets along well. Bat Boy is a true toy fan and likes to carry his favorite around, entertaining himself when the mood strikes. When it’s time to relax, he wants to be right next to his people, quietly content. He’s as happy stretched out for a cuddle as he is during playtime. He previously lived with children, including a baby as young as six months old, and was once registered as an emotional support animal, which gives some insight into his gentle and steady demeanor.
